You've probably heard about using a spray bottle on your plants before. It's very easy to assume that spraying your plant is the same as watering your plant because your plant is getting moisture. But this is a common misconception: using a spray bottle on your plant raises the humidity of the air around your plant and doesn't water the plant properly. Anthurium has low to medium watering needs; despite being exotic, it does not get too thirsty. Allow the soil to dry almost completely before watering, as long as it is not fully dry. Also known asflamingo flowers, these flamboyant, glossy-leaved houseplants comefrom tropical climes, so must be kept in warm, humid conditions and indirect light. They are compact enough to fit into anyhome, as most are only about30cm (1ft) tall. Make sure your Anthurium is not exposed to direct sunlight as it can scorch the leaves. When placing it outside, put your Anthurium under a shady spot or a filtered light area. Also, Anthuriums require a high level of humidity, so it's important to keep the soil moist and mist the leaves frequently to prevent them from drying out.
